Rwanda's Growing Security Industry
Rwanda is widely recognized as one of the safest countries in Africa, and its private security industry plays a meaningful role in maintaining that reputation. As Kigali continues to develop into a regional business hub, demand for professional guarding, electronic surveillance, and risk management services has expanded rapidly. Banks, embassies, hotels, residential estates, and fast-growing startups all rely on trusted security partners to safeguard their people and assets.
The modern Rwandan security company is no longer limited to manned guarding. The sector now blends trained personnel with CCTV monitoring, access control, alarm response, cash-in-transit logistics, and integrated command centers. This evolution reflects both rising client expectations and Rwanda's broader push toward a knowledge-based, service-oriented economy.
What Sets the Best Security Companies Apart
The most respected firms in Rwanda distinguish themselves through rigorous guard training, reliable response times, and transparent operations. Many invest heavily in vetting procedures, uniformed professionalism, and continuous supervision to ensure consistent service quality. Increasingly, clients also evaluate providers based on their technology stack, including remote monitoring, GPS-tracked patrols, and digital incident reporting.
Compliance and accountability matter just as much as capability. Leading companies maintain clear licensing, insurance coverage, and adherence to national regulations, giving clients confidence that they are working with legitimate, dependable partners.

Technology and the Future of Security in Rwanda
Technology adoption is a defining trend across Rwanda's security landscape. Smart surveillance, cloud-based monitoring, and data-driven patrol management are increasingly common among top-tier providers. These tools improve accountability, reduce response times, and allow clients to receive real-time updates about their premises.
As Rwanda continues attracting foreign investment and hosting international events, the security industry is expected to professionalize even further. Companies that combine well-trained personnel with advanced systems are best positioned to lead the market in the years ahead.
